Step 1: Assessing the Damage
We start by assessing the damage to your property, identifying the source of the water and the extent of the damage. Our experts use specialized equipment to detect any hidden water pockets or areas of damage.
Step 2: Creating a Personalized Plan
Based on our assessment, we create a customized plan to address your specific needs. This plan includes the equipment and techniques we’ll use to remove water from your property.
Step 3: Removing Water with Submersible Pumps
We use our advanced submersible pumps to remove water from your property. These pumps are designed to handle up to 2 inches of standing water and can move large volumes of water quickly and efficiently.
Step 4: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been removed, we use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your property.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and ensuring your property is safe and healthy.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Clean-up
We conduct a final inspection to ensure your property is fully dry and safe. We also clean up any debris or mess left behind, leaving your property in its original state.

Submersible Pump Water Extraction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ak in a single room | Yes | No | DIY can handle small leaks, but if the leak is large or widespread, call a pro. |
| Water damage from a burst pipe | No | Yes | A burst pipe needs immediate attention from a professional to prevent further damage. |
| Submersible pump water extraction for a large area | No | Yes | A large area of water damage needs specialized equipment and expertise to handle efficiently. |
| Hidden water pockets or areas of damage | No | Yes | Hidden water pockets or areas of damage need specialized equipment and expertise to detect and address. |
| Water damage from a natural disaster | No | Yes | A natural disaster needs immediate attention from a professional to prevent further damage and ensure safety. |
| Water damage from a sewer backup | No | Yes | A sewer backup needs immediate attention from a professional to prevent further damage and ensure safety. |
